Hangzhou RoboCT Technology Development Co.,Ltd
RoboCT designs and builds AI-native lower-limb exoskeleton robots combining intelligent control systems, gait-adaptive algorithms and robotic core components (including its own motorized mecanum wheels and precision motion control). Products span clinical rehabilitation (UGO, KidGO, bedside/DEUS series) and consumer daily-mobility devices (EasyGo, GoGo) with adaptive walk/stand/cadence assist modes. It was the first Chinese firm to obtain NMPA registration for lower-limb exoskeleton robots treating central neuropathy, and holds FDA registration and CE certification for overseas markets.

EasyGo
- 2.5kg, battery-free mechanical-support exoskeleton priced at RMB2,500; reduces user effort ~10%; sold out within 15 seconds at online launch
Consumer-grade passive exoskeleton assistive device for stairs and long walks

GoGo
- 2.3kg per side (excluding battery); up to 25km range; adaptive Walk, Stand/Sit, Cadence Assist and Swing Assist modes
Lightweight powered consumer exoskeleton for daily mobility, post-stroke and Parkinson's support, unveiled at CES 2026

UGO
- Lower-limb rehabilitation exoskeleton deployed in 700+ hospitals; first in China with NMPA registration for central neuropathy (paraplegia, hemiplegia, cerebral palsy)
Clinical rehab exoskeleton robot that retrains gait for spinal-cord-injury, stroke and lower-limb weakness patients
